1. A coupling for joining a first pipe and a second pipe, the coupling comprising:

  • an upper housing;

    a lower housing;

    at least one fastening device coupling the upper housing to the lower housing; and

    a gasket positioned within the upper and lower housings, the gasket includingtwo primary seals, each primary seal formed on an outer edge of the gasket and having a rounded interior end, the rounded interior end having a rounded portion facing radially inward, anda rib protruding from an inner surface of the gasket and between the two primary seals, the rib having a sealing surface defining a first axially outer edge, a second axially outer edge, and a cylindrical section facing radially inward, the cylindrical section being cylindrical when the at least one fastening device is in an untightened condition, the cylindrical section defined between the first axially outer edge and the second axially outer edge,the gasket adapted to slide over the first pipe end such that at least a portion of the first pipe extends axially beyond each edge of the gasket, a first primary seal of the two primary seals and the sealing surface of the rib contactable with an exterior surface of the first pipe when the first pipe and the second pipe are joined end-to-end; and

    a second primary seal of the two primary seals and the sealing surface of the rib contactable with an-exterior surface of the second pipe when the first pipe and the second pipe are joined end-to-end.
